Adar
Meanings
name
- The sixth month of the civil year and the twelfth month of the ecclesiastical year in the Jewish calendar, after Shevat and before Nisan. See also Adar Sheni.
noun
- The enzyme adenosine deaminase that affects RNA, important in editing nuclear double stranded RNAs (from A to I) in higher eukaryotes, that work by acting to convert adenosines to insosines via hydrolytic deamination.

Etymology
From Hebrew אֲדָר (adár). Doublet of Addaru.
